RE/MAX® CANADA
QUEST FOR EXCELLENCE® SCHOLARSHIP PROGRAM
OFFICIAL RULES
The Quest for Excellence Scholarship Program (the “Program”) is sponsored by RE/MAX Promotions, Inc. (“Sponsor”). The Program opens on September 9, 2024 at 12:01 a.m. ET and closes on March 9, 2025 at 11:59 p.m. ET (the “Entry Period”).

1. Eligibility
Students who will graduate from high school during the academic year 2024- 2025 and reside in and are legal residents of Canada, excluding Quebec, are eligible to apply (each an “Applicant”). Non-traditional students completing high school equivalency courses are not eligible to apply or win. Residents of Quebec are not eligible to apply or win.
Employees of Sponsor and its affiliated companies, and their immediate families and household members, are not eligible to apply or win.
Eligibility will be determined in Sponsor’s sole discretion. Sponsor reserves the right to disqualify any submission or Applicant it finds, in its sole discretion, to be ineligible for any reason including, but not limited to, fraud or deceptive activity. Any Scholarship Award inadvertently delivered to an Applicant who ought to have been disqualified by these Official Rules will be reclaimed by Sponsor.
All submissions that are incomplete, illegible, damaged, irregular, have been submitted through illicit means, or do not conform to or satisfy any condition of these Official Rules may be disqualified. By submitting an application, Applicants acknowledge compliance with these Official Rules, including all eligibility requirements.
2. How to Apply
To apply, complete the submission form available at https://preprod-blog.remax.ca/quest-for-excellence/, indicate your acceptance of the terms, and submit an original, personal essay (the “Essay”) based on one of three key themes: (1) charitable community contributions, (2) the vision for a “brighter future,” or (3) ensuring future generations have a safe, secure, and affordable place to call “home”. The Essay must be (1) responsive to one of the three themes provided; (2) minimum 500 words; and (3) cohesive and grammatically correct, in Sponsor’s sole discretion (the “Essay Criteria”).
One submission per person.
3. Selection of Award Recipients
Forty (40) Applicants will be selected to receive a scholarship award of one-thousand dollars ($1,000 CAD) (the “Scholarship Award”).
The potential award recipients will be selected via random drawing from all eligible entries. The odds of winning depend on the number of eligible entries received. No purchase necessary to apply or win.
Following the selection, for each potential award recipient, RE/MAX will (1) confirm eligibility, including verifying high school enrollment and graduation status; and (2) review the Essay and confirm it meets the Essay Criteria.
If a potential award recipient fails to respond to communication from Sponsor within a five (5) day period, fails to provide identification, fails to comply with the Official Rules, fails to meet the Essay Criteria, or if the notification is consistently returned as undeliverable or fails to reach a selected entrant for any reason or if potential award winner fails to respond for any reason to the communication as directed, or if the potential award winner’s high school fails to respond to the communication or fails to confirm enrollment and graduation status, that potential award recipient will be disqualified and an alternate Applicant will be selected and contacted and undergo the same confirmation process within five (5) business days of the alternative Applicant being contacted. All decisions of the Sponsor are final.
The Scholarship Award will be delivered to confirmed award recipients within sixty (60) days of the end of the Entry Period and will be delivered by mail or in-person at a local RE/MAX office.
